#c0cd16 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c0cd16 is composed of 75.3% red, 80.4%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.3%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 64.3 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 44.5%. #c0cd16 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ff2c with #819b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#c0cd16 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c0cd16 has RGB values of R:192, G:205,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 12635414.

Shades and Tints of #c0cd16

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090a01 is the darkest color, while #fefef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c0cd16

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#75766d is the less saturated color, while #cfde05 is the most saturated one.
